Understanding Stablecoins and Their Role
Stablecoins like USDC are crucial for several reasons:
- **Reduced Volatility:** They provide a safe haven during market downturns, allowing traders to preserve capital.
- **Easy Entry and Exit:** Switching between a volatile asset like ETH and a stablecoin like USDC is quick and easy, facilitating frequent trading.
- **Pair Trading Opportunities:** They form the basis for pair trading strategies, where you simultaneously buy and sell related assets to profit from temporary discrepancies in their price relationship.
- **Hedging:** Stablecoins can be used to hedge against potential losses in other cryptocurrency holdings.
Spot Trading with ETH/USDC
Spot trading involves the immediate exchange of ETH for USDC (or vice versa). This is the most straightforward way to participate in the ETH/USDC flow.
- **Basic Strategy:** Buy ETH when you believe its price will increase, and sell it when you believe it will decrease. The difference between your buying and selling price, minus trading fees, is your profit.
- **Range Trading:** Identify a price range within which ETH is consistently trading. Buy at the lower end of the range and sell at the upper end. This requires identifying support and resistance levels.
- **Momentum Trading:** Capitalize on short-term price trends. If ETH’s price is rising rapidly, buy in anticipation of further gains. If it’s falling, sell. Tools like the Introduction au RSI (Relative Strength Index) pour le trading de contrats à terme. can help identify momentum.
- **Dollar-Cost Averaging (DCA):** Invest a fixed amount of USDC into ETH at regular intervals, regardless of the price. This reduces the impact of volatility and can lead to a lower average purchase price over time.

- **Long Positions:** Betting that ETH’s price will increase. You buy a futures contract, and if the price rises above your purchase price, you profit.
- **Short Positions:** Betting that ETH’s price will decrease. You sell a futures contract, and if the price falls below your selling price, you profit.
- **Leverage:** Futures trading offers leverage, which means you can control a larger position with a smaller amount of capital. While this can increase profits, it also significantly increases risk. Be extremely cautious when using leverage.
- **Funding Rates:** In perpetual futures contracts (common on platforms like Futures Trading on Bitget), funding rates are paid between long and short positions to keep the contract price close to the spot price. Understanding funding rates is crucial for profitability.

Risk Management is Paramount
The ETH/USDC flow, while potentially profitable, isn’t without risk. Effective risk management is essential.
- **Stop-Loss Orders:** Automatically sell your position if the price reaches a predetermined level, limiting potential losses.
- **Position Sizing:** Never risk more than a small percentage of your capital on a single trade (e.g., 1-2%).
- **Diversification:** Don’t put all your eggs in one basket. Diversify your portfolio across multiple cryptocurrencies and trading strategies.
- **Take-Profit Orders:** Automatically sell your position when the price reaches a predetermined profit target.
- **Understand Leverage:** If using futures, carefully consider the risks of leverage. Start with low leverage and gradually increase it as you gain experience.
